Early diagnosis and treatment of growing skull fracture

摘要

Background: Growing skull fracture (GSF) is a rare complication of pediatric skull fractures and causes delayed-onset neurological deficits and cranial asymmetry. Early treatment is pivotal to prevent those complications. The aim of this study is to highlight the early diagnosis and treatment of GSFs. Materials and Methods: Between January 2000 and June 2013; 6,916 children with linear fracture were treated in three separate hospitals. Inclusion criteria were: Patients who were diagnosed and treated within 30 days and had one or more following features: (a) 3 years or less age with cephalohematoma; (b) seizures immediate to the injury; (c) underlying brain damage; and (d) bone diastasis 4 mm or more. A review was retrospectively carried out to identify those patients who had early diagnosis and surgical intervention. Results: Eighty-six patients met the inclusion criteria and all had magnetic resonance imaging (MRI) brain scans. Twenty-two patients had GSF, fall was the most frequent cause of injury and cephalohematomas the most common symptom. The most common injury site was the parietal region. Early surgical repair of dura and skull was associated with good outcomes. Conclusions: The patients aged 3 years or less with cephalohematoma, underlying brain damage, bone diastasis ≥4 mm on computed tomography (CT), and seizures immediate to the injury were high risk group for developing GSFs. Early diagnosis and surgical treatment of GSF can yield a good outcome.
机译:背景:颅骨骨折不断发展(GSF)是小儿颅骨骨折的罕见并发症,会导致迟发性神经功能缺损和颅骨不对称。早期治疗对于预防这些并发症至关重要。这项研究的目的是强调GSF的早期诊断和治疗。材料与方法:2000年1月至2013年6月; 6,916名患有线性骨折的儿童在三所不同的医院接受了治疗。纳入标准为:在30天内被诊断和治疗并且具有以下一项或多项特征的患者:(a)3岁或以下的头颅血肿; (b)在受伤后立即发作; (c)潜在的脑损伤; (d)4毫米或以上的骨转移。回顾性地进行了回顾,以鉴定那些具有早期诊断和手术干预的患者。结果:86例患者符合入选标准,均接受了磁共振成像(MRI)脑部扫描。 22例患者患有GSF,跌倒是最常见的损伤原因,头颅血肿是最常见的症状。最常见的损伤部位是顶区。早期硬脑膜和颅骨的外科手术修复具有良好的效果。结论:3岁或以下的头颅血肿,潜在的脑损伤,计算机断层扫描(CT)上的骨转移≥4 mm以及受伤后立即发作的患者是发生GSF的高危人群。 GSF的早期诊断和手术治疗可产生良好的效果。
